Punto DM 14

Name

大椎

  • Da Zhui
  • Great vertebra
  • Great protuberance

Location

  • Below C7
  • Sometimes C7 is not the most prominent vertebra. To make sure you locate it correctly, touch the transverse processes of the neck and ask the person to turn their head from side to side. C7 moves while T1 does not.

Nature

Actions

  • Major neck point. All problems, pain, neck stiffness, nape GV-14 + GB-20, BL-10
  • Major point for the entire upper limb: motor problems (paralysis), pain, tingling: major point for cervicobrachial syndrome
  • Eliminates external pathogens, especially Heat or Wind-Heat: GV-14 + LI-11 + LI-4 if there is fever. Bleed.
  • Raise Yang in cases of exhaustion: in Wind-Cold attack with Moxa
  • Tonifies in cases of exhaustion from overwork, fatigue, fibromyalgia, sweating with minimal effort, poor concentration, poor memory, tiredness + GV-4
  • Effect on Blood and the immune system: increases white blood cells
  • Hypertension, epilepsy, insomnia, epistaxis

Comments

  • Relaxes the Sympathetic Nervous System.
  • Moxibustion increases white blood cells, boosting the immune system (for people undergoing chemotherapy and radiation)

Treatment

  • Needling: 0.3-1 CUN oblique. Bleed and scrape
  • Moxa
